Season 3 Of True Detective Is In The Works, But Not Confirmed

The last time we saw True Detective on HBO was two years ago, a good amount of time for a show to be off the air. But after all that time, it appears that the show is making progress towards a season 3. There’ve been reports saying that Nic Pizzolatto, the creator of the first two seasons, has written at least the first two episodes of the next season. Also, that David Milch, creator of Deadwood and co-creator ofย NYPD Blue, is planning on helping Pizzolatto with the next season. Although these are the reports as of now, the third season of True Detective has yet to be confirmed. There’s also no set showrunner for the next season as of now (if it were to get the green light).

The mere possibility of a third season is good news, especially after the beating the critics gave the second season. It isn’t old news that season 2 fell short of expectationsย after what was seen in the first season. I believe fans didn’t like the second season as much because it didn’t meet the standards of what they saw in 2014 with the first season. I personally still enjoyed the second season, but I can agree that it didn’t compare to the first. The first, in my opinion, was almost perfect. It’s hard to create something of similar quality twice in a row. This being the case, I’m sure the time off has done Pizzolatto good. It’s possible that he felt rushed writing the second season, so, as a result, the finished product didn’t come out as great as the first season (in which he had a lot of time to prepare). But with almost two years gone by, I’m sure he’s come up with some material worthy of the True Detective name. Let’s just hope that he gets the green light to begin production.

As there’s no individual set to be the showrunner, the third season could very well be done by someone else other than Pizzolatto. If this were the case, reports say that he would most likely still oversee the production. HBO wants a third season and believes it’s an important franchise, but they aren’t jumping the gun on this one. It appears that they’re waiting for the right time to give a third season of the show the green light, as Pizzolatto is working on some other projects at the moment.

Matthew McConahauey stated back in December that he’d be willing to reprise his role of Rust Cohle, a main character in the first season. This would be interesting to see. Mostly because True Detective is an anthology series, so including a character from a previous story line could either be a bad or great thing. Him coming back to the series ultimately depends on what sort of direction the writers decide on goingย in with theย third season. Unfortunately, Detective Rust Cohle may have solved his last case back in season 1. Fingers crossed that he’s up for one more.
